Special Visitor

About six or seven weeks ago I had noticed a pair of Mistle Thrushes had taken ownership of an area around a rowan tree. Then recently the flock of waxwings came in and that was the end of the rowan feast, so I expected the Thrushes to depart. However they have stayed around the Salters Road area and I had seen them edging closer to our chimney pots.

So I was over the moon to see them, this morning, visiting the garden feeder.
Have to confess I was on the way out, so the pic was taken through the square window, and it was raining, but I cannot wait to use it. What a cracking bird!
